Well my alternater finally gave up the ghost as well did my battery.
Both lived a long life of 2 years. They are survived by the various other parts that belong to my 2001 Chevrolet Silverado.
Each item was upgraded tho.
For the alternator replacement i went with the 130A alternator for a Denali.
Seems to work pretty good considering that the stock alternator for theese trucks are 105A. Bolted right in. Its a tad bit bigger to diffinently noticable.
